Indonesian Meaning of mozambique channel

Selat Mozambik

Other Indonesian words related to Selat Mozambik

No Synonyms and anytonyms found

Definitions and Meaning of mozambique channel in English

Wordnet

mozambique channel (n)

an arm of the Indian Ocean between Madagascar and southeastern Africa

FAQs About the word mozambique channel

Selat Mozambik

an arm of the Indian Ocean between Madagascar and southeastern Africa

No synonyms found.

No antonyms found.

mozambique => Mozambik, mozambican => Mozambik, moynihan => Moynihan, moyle => Moyle, moya => moya,